ICRC negotiating with Azerbaijan on guarantees of maintaining ceasefire during farm work

11:59, 21 July, 2014

YEREVAN, JULY 21, ARMENPRESS. The International Committee of the Red Cross (ICRC) is negotiating with the Azerbaijani authorities on the guarantees of maintaining the ceasefire regime during the farm work in the border communities of Armenia's Tavush Province. In a conversation with “Armenpress”, the Head of Communication Programs of the Yerevan Office of the International Committee of the Red Cross Zara Amatuni stated that they encourage, when people turn to them for help in case of necessity.

Among other things, the Head of Communication Programs of the Yerevan Office of the International Committee of the Red Cross Zara Amatuni underscored: "When they turn to us to provide security during the realization of certain activities, we start the process and begin negotiations to get guarantees. We deploy our employee to that territory with his vehicle." In addition, the Head of Communication Programs of the Yerevan Office of the International Committee of the Red Cross Zara Amatuni noted that currently they are involved in the talks.
